    Re: Lenovo i7 X220 Graphic performances

    I got just about the same score when I utilized the 65W connector on i7.
    • Processor: 7.1
    • Memory (RAM): 7.5
    • Graphics: 5.0
    • Gaming graphics: 6.1
    • Primary hard disk: 7.4

    -------------------------------------------------------------------
    Nonetheless, when I utilized the 90W (non-thin) connector, I got
    • Processor: 7.1
    • Memory (RAM): 7.5
    • Graphics: 6.3
    • Gaming graphics: 6.3
    • Primary hard disk: 7.4

    WEI might be shift about 0.1-0.2 on the same framework at a certain point, but the bouncing from 5.0 to 6.3 is originating from throttling issue.

    Re: Lenovo i7 X220 Graphic performances

    Consistent with my information for i7 you ought to run WEI with 90W capacity connector. The 65W connector will have throttling situation consequence in more level WEI score.
